Things to do in Montgomery?Montgomery, Alabama is a city full of history and charm. It was the site of the famous Montgomery Bus boycott of 1955-56 and was also the capital of the Confederacy during the Civil War. Today, Montgomery is filled with unique attractions like Riverwalk Stadium, which features a 3D light show and interactive exhibits as well as concerts and other special cultural events. Visitors can also explore downtown Montgomery’s historic district where they will find quaint shops and restaurants. There are many museums dedicated to various aspects of Montgomery’s history such as civil rights, military service, the Alabama State Capitol building, Montgomery Zoo, Blount Cultural Park and more! Along with all its historical sites and attractions, visitors will also find plenty of outdoor activities to enjoy in Montgomery including camping, fishing, biking trails and golfing.
